Ingredients

  • 1 Tbsp brown sugar
  • 1 Tbsp fish sauce
  • 1 Tbsp low sodium soy sauce
  • 1 Tbsp lime juice
  • 1 tsp ground chile paste
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 bunch green onions
  • 2 Tbsp peanut oil
  • 2 1/2 cup cooked and cooled brown rice
  • 1/4 cup vertically sliced shallots
  • 12 oz of chicken breast cut into pieces
  • 2 cups broccoli florets
  • 1 cup julienne cut red pepper
  • 1 1/2 tsp minced garlic
  • 2 bacon slices
  • 4 lime wedges

Details

Servings 4
Preparation time 25mins
Cooking time 50mins

Preparation

Step 1

Combine first 4 ingredients, 1/2 tsp chile paste and 1/8 tsp salt. Combine eggs and remaining chile paste. Separate green tops from green onions and chop diagonally into one inch pieces.
Heat skillets and add peanut oil. Add rice and sitr fry for 1 1/2 minutes. Transfer rice to bowl. Stir fry shallots and chicken until browned. Add brown sugar mixture and simmer until thickens. Add chicken to rice. Stir fry broccoli and pepper until tender. Then add green onion and garlic and fry for one minute. Add chcie an cook 2 minutes. Add egg mixture to small frying pan and cook for 30 seconds, Chop egg and bacon and add to rice mixture. Top with green onion tops and garnish with lime wedges.
